Hati wolf notes

I went out to kill the Hati wolf after lunch and here's what I know for sure:

- magic exp counts with teleports and hi alching
- head and paws can happen in a single drop
- easier to kill with a group (today/tomorrow good if you don't have friends/clan)

Speculation:

- attacks with magic
- consensus says it has low defense

What I don't know:

- do damage to get drops or just attack or just be near it? (mine died in 5 hits, idk if I did any damage)
- what to wear? (mine died in 5 hits and no one took damage)
